The Foundational Role of Protein in Brain Function
Protein is more than just a muscle-building macronutrient; it is fundamental to the architecture and operation of the brain. The building blocks of protein, called amino acids, are the precursors for many critical neurotransmitters. Neurotransmitters are the chemical messengers that transmit signals throughout the brain and nervous system, influencing everything from mood and sleep to concentration and motivation.
The Neurotransmitter Connection: How Amino Acids Affect Mood
When protein intake is insufficient, the body’s supply of specific amino acids drops. This, in turn, can compromise the synthesis of the neurotransmitters responsible for maintaining a stable mood.
- Serotonin: The "feel-good" neurotransmitter, serotonin, is synthesized from the essential amino acid tryptophan. Inadequate protein intake can reduce the amount of tryptophan available to cross the blood-brain barrier, leading to lower serotonin levels and contributing to depressive symptoms, irritability, and anxiety.
- Dopamine and Norepinephrine: The amino acid tyrosine is the precursor for dopamine and norepinephrine, neurotransmitters crucial for focus, motivation, and the body’s stress response. A deficiency can lead to a dip in these chemicals, affecting alertness and emotional regulation.
Blood Sugar Stability and Mood Swings
Another significant impact of low protein intake is the destabilization of blood sugar levels. Protein, when consumed with carbohydrates, slows down the absorption of glucose into the bloodstream, preventing dramatic spikes and crashes. Without this stabilizing effect, individuals may experience rapid fluctuations in blood sugar, leading to mood swings, irritability, and anxiety. This link is so pronounced that the term “hangry” (hunger-induced anger) is widely understood.
Fatigue, Brain Fog, and Physical Symptoms
Chronic fatigue and low energy are among the most common physical signs of protein deficiency and are also hallmark symptoms of depression. Proteins are essential for producing hemoglobin, which carries oxygen to the brain and other organs. A shortage can lead to anemia, worsening feelings of fatigue and low mental alertness. Beyond neurotransmitter function, low protein intake can also manifest as “brain fog,” difficulty concentrating, and memory issues, further mimicking or exacerbating depressive episodes.
The Role of Supporting Nutrients and the Gut-Brain Axis
While protein is crucial, it's part of a larger nutritional picture. The synthesis of mood-regulating neurotransmitters also depends on cofactors like B vitamins, and overall brain health relies on other key nutrients.
- B Vitamins and Minerals: Vitamins B6 and B12, along with minerals like zinc and magnesium, are vital for synthesizing and metabolizing neurotransmitters. Deficiencies in these areas are also linked to an increased risk of depression.
- Omega-3 Fatty Acids: Found in high concentrations in the brain, omega-3s are critical for optimal brain function. Studies show a correlation between low omega-3 intake and higher rates of depression.
- The Gut-Brain Axis: The gut produces about 90% of the body's serotonin. A healthy gut microbiome, supported by a diet rich in fiber, healthy fats, and nutrients, is essential for optimal serotonin production. A diet low in protein and overall nutrients can negatively impact gut health, disrupting this critical axis.

How to Ensure Adequate Protein Intake
Incorporating a variety of high-quality protein sources into your daily diet is the best way to support your mental and physical health. This helps ensure your body receives a complete profile of essential amino acids.
- Animal Sources: Lean meats, poultry, eggs, fish (especially fatty fish rich in omega-3s like salmon), and dairy products such as Greek yogurt and cheese.
- Plant-Based Sources: Legumes, lentils, nuts, seeds, and soy products like tofu and tempeh. A combination of different plant-based proteins can help ensure a full amino acid profile.
- Distribute Intake: Spread protein intake throughout the day, rather than consuming a large amount in one meal. This helps maintain a steady supply of amino acids for brain function.
Conclusion: Can lack of protein cause depression?
While a lack of protein is not the sole cause of clinical depression, the evidence strongly suggests it can contribute significantly to its symptoms and severity. By providing the essential building blocks for neurotransmitters, stabilizing blood sugar, and supporting overall brain health, adequate protein intake is a foundational pillar of mental well-being. Addressing a protein deficiency, alongside other vital nutrients, should be considered a crucial part of a holistic approach to managing and preventing mood disorders. For serious or persistent mental health issues, it is always best to consult a healthcare professional for a proper diagnosis and treatment plan.
